EVALUATION OF TUBULARIZED INCISED PLATE URETHROPLASTY FOR MANAGEMENT OF DISTAL PENILE HYPOSPADIAS

Abstract


Hypospadias is a congenital anomaly in which the urethral meatus tenninates on the ventral surface of the penis proximal to the normal site. It is a common congenital anomaly of the male urethra with an incidence of
3.2 in every 1000 live male birth.

Hypospadias is classified according to the anatomical site of hypospadias meatus into: glanular, distal penile, midpenile, penoscrotal, scrotal and perineal hypospadias. It can be also classified on a practical base into:
• Simple forms (anterior hypospadias) that need simple


corrective procedures.


• Sever forms (posterior hypospadias) that need more complicated corrective procedures.
There is no single known cause of hypospadias; unquestionably a

genetic factor exists, most likely based on a multifactorial mode of inheritance. • Hypospadias may be a • local manifestation of an• endocrinopathy rather than a local dysmorpbic problem and major cause may be a delay in maturation of hypothalamic- pituitary testicular axis and poor testicular response to human chorionic gonadotrophin injection.
